Yurt in Ohiopyle
Description
The Yurt, situated at Rafferty Manor, built in 1918, located in Ohiopyle State Park, on the Youghiogheny, the rustic yurt was built circa 1920. It is in the perfect location for the outdoor enthusiast and architectual aficionados, between two Frank Lloyd Wright homes; Fallingwater (2.7 miles) and Kentuck Knob (1.7 miles). Managed by an artist, you will find all the amenities one would need to have a break from the outside world. The space The yurt has two single beds, with box spring and mattress, linens and pillows. Hardwood floor throughout and open windows with screens. Lights in/out & a power strip for your charging needs. Shower and bathrooms are next door in the change house, which is shared with other outdoor enthusiasts. In colder months, when change house is closed, guests may use the main house for shower and bathroom. Keep in mind, this is a hard frame yurt experience, you are outdoors, in a yurt...not indoors of a house. There is no fridge, WiFi or AC, this is a yurt, outside! Guest access Guests can access the lower property that is fenced in from the street. Boat racks for overnight storage. Change house (men’s & women’s side)next door (shared with other outdoor enthusiasts) for shower/bathrooms during warmer season, change house closed off season, guests can use main house for shower needs off season. Ample parking and access to garage for storage if needed.n Other things to note There is a train line that moves through town 24/7, if your a light sleeper, just a forewarning heads-up. If your not adventurous and outdoorsy then this may not the place for you-think about it...do you need a hotel perhaps? The yurt is located in the hub of Ohiopyle (which means on weekends this area can be a bit celebratory), with intentional usage for an adventurous 'glamping' lifestyle from bikers on the GAP, boaters on the Yough and hikers on the Laurel Highlands Hiking Trail. The river outfitter is across the street for easy access if your planning on river or biking experiences. Pub next door for 25 on-tap beer selection, bike trail is a stones throw away as is the river for a nightly plunge.
